Patrizio Neff
University Duisburg-Essen
Boundary Conditions In The Indeterminate Couple Stress Model: New Perspectives
Aifantis International Symposium (2nd Intl. symp. on Multiscale Material Mechanics in the 21st Century)[Gradient Elasticity ]
Back to Plenary Lectures »
|
Abstract:
We reconsider the Toupin-Mindlin indeterminate couple stress model being one of the prominent gradient elasticity models. While abundantly used for the description of nano-sized materials, some theoretical issues concerning boundary conditions and constitutive assumptions need discussion. We provide an improved set of independent boundary conditions making it possible to uniquely identify material properties. In addition, we highlight the connections to the more general gradient elasticity models.
